Vue.js是什么?·更互动·使用虚拟DOM提高页面渲染速度
Vue.js是什么?
Vue.js,听起来像是法语,但其实是一种流行的JavaScript框架。它的名字来源于法语单词“Vue”,意思是“在视线内”或“在视野中”。在技术领域,Vue.js主要用于构建用户界面,让网页看起来更漂亮、更互动。
Vue.js的核心特性
Vue.js有几个特别的地方,让它变得非常受欢迎:
- 响应式数据绑定:数据变化,界面跟着变。
- 组件化开发:像拼图一样,把界面拆成小块。
- 虚拟DOM:提高页面加载速度。
- 渐进式框架:不需要一步到位,逐步学习。
Vue.js的使用方法
Vue.js使用起来很简单,下面是一些基本的步骤:
- 安装Vue.js:在你的项目中加入Vue.js。
- 声明数据:设置一些变量,Vue会帮你同步到界面。
- 创建组件:把界面拆成一个个小块。
- 使用虚拟DOM:提高页面渲染速度。
Vue.js的优势与劣势
Vue.js有几个优点,但也有些需要注意的地方:
优势 | 劣势 |
---|---|
易于上手 | 生态系统相对较小 |
高性能 | 企业支持较少 |
灵活性强 | 学习曲线 |
Vue.js的实际应用案例
Vue.js在业界已经有很多成功的应用案例,比如:
- 阿里巴巴:在多个项目中使用Vue.js,提升用户体验。
- 百度地图:前端界面使用Vue.js,提高开发效率。
- GitLab:Web界面使用Vue.js,使应用更加响应和高效。
如何开始学习Vue.js
想要学习Vue.js?以下是一些建议:
- 官方文档:Vue.js的官方文档非常全面,是学习的最佳起点。
- 在线课程:很多在线教育平台提供了Vue.js的课程。
- 实践项目:通过实际项目来提升你的技能。
Vue.js是一个强大且灵活的JavaScript框架,非常适合前端开发。通过学习Vue.js,你可以更高效地构建网页,提升用户体验。